Texas Instruments · Analog Switches, Multiplexers · SOT-23-5
TS5A4595DBVR from Texas Instruments, in a SOT-23-5. Pinout and pin descriptions extracted from the manufacturer datasheet by ds2sf; symbol, footprint, and 3D from KiCad-official CAD.
Pinout
| Pin | Name | Type | Function |
|---|---|---|---|
| 1 | COM | passive | Switch common analog terminal. Bidirectional analog/digital signal port, 0 to V+ signal range, connected to NC when the switch is ON. |
| 2 | NC | passive | Switch normally-closed analog throw terminal. Bidirectional analog/digital signal port, 0 to V+ signal range; connected to COM when IN is low (switch ON) and isolated when IN is high (switch OFF). |
| 3 | GND | power_in | Ground reference. Continuous current through GND rated -100 mA. |
| 4 | IN | input | Digital control input, TTL/CMOS-compatible, 5.5-V tolerant. IN = L closes the switch (COM↔NC ON); IN = H opens the switch (OFF). V_IH ≥ 2.4 V (5-V supply) or ≥ 2 V (3-V supply); V_IL ≤ 0.8 V. |
| 5 | V+ | power_in | Positive supply, 2 V to 5.5 V single-supply operation (absolute max 6 V). Quiescent current I+ typ 0.01 µA, max 0.25 µA at 5 V. |
